Transaction 2c51b761d2fcf4499868d39d97dd6a717d2cee1ecc50e26ed4db8a12821f59f0

56 Input
2 Outputs
  • 2c51b761d2fcf4499868d39d97dd6a717d2cee1ecc50e26ed4db8a12821f59f0:0
  • value  105944
    address  1FsfXCmUTj48oKGKQCpoHj6PiMT6R4tE9Z
  • 2c51b761d2fcf4499868d39d97dd6a717d2cee1ecc50e26ed4db8a12821f59f0:1
  • value  205008000
    address  18vNWVWtENZZypWssYXmAnGom9nWBWqG77